    So how do you hook it up to the jet pump/diverter?

  7. #7
    BrendellaJet
    If its anything like the VDO setup there is a cable thats run to the hydraulic pump ram, the other end runs to the sender, which works similar to a fuel tank sender, the cable acts like the floating ball and moves the lever based on movement from the diverter. Resistance signal is sent to gauge...
